⩥ Merchantilism. Answer:Economic policy used by the British in which
the colonies served as a source of raw materials and a market to sell
goods to.
⩥ Salutary Neglect. Answer:Period of time when the British ignored the
colonists because they only wanted the economic prosperity
⩥ Virginia House of Burgesses/Mayflower Compact/Town Hall.
Answer:Early forms of colonial efforts in self government, contributed
to a representative democracy
⩥ French and Indian War. Answer:Caused by land claims in the Ohio
River valley, led to a period of salutary neglect, British increased taxes
on the colonies to pay for this
⩥ Albany Plan of Union. Answer:Attempt to unify the colonists together
under British rule, Didn't work because colonists wanted to keep their
power
,⩥ Declaration of Independence. Answer:List of grievances against the
monarchy in Britain
⩥ Thomas Paine "Common Sense". Answer:Helped persuade colonists
to join the fight for independence, convinced many who were undecided
⩥ Sugar and Stamp Act. Answer:Tax on foreign goods and printed
materials helped cause the Revolutionary War
⩥ Proclamation Line of 1763. Answer:border established by Great
Britain in order to avoid conflict between the American colonists and
Native Americans
⩥ Articles of Confederation. Answer:First government after the
Revolutionary War, failed because the states were too powerful and the
national government was too weak
⩥ Shay's Rebellion. Answer:Convinced many Americans they needed a
stronger national government
⩥ Great Compromise. Answer:Disputes over representation in
government, decided to have a two house legislature, with both equal
and population based representation
⩥ Small States. Answer:Supported equal representation
, ⩥ Large States. Answer:Supported population based representation
⩥ Bicameral. Answer:Two House Legislature
⩥ Three-Fifths Compromise. Answer:Solution to the problem of how to
determine the number of representatives in the House of Rep for states
with large slave populations
⩥ Federalists. Answer:Supported ratification of the Constitution, wanted
strong national government
⩥ Antifederalists. Answer:Supported ratification of the Constitution,
ONLY if they added the Bill of Rights, were afraid that the fed
government would be too powerful (like Britain)
⩥ Bill of Rights. Answer:first 10 amendments to protect the people from
government abuse
⩥ Social Contract Theory. Answer:John Locke's idea of people deciding
which government/consent of the governed
⩥ John Peter Zenger. Answer:Arrested by the governor of NY, because
he printed an article about the governor, expanded freedom of the press
